技术文摘
JavaScript 怎样获取一个 id
在JavaScript编程中,获取一个id是一项基础且常用的操作。了解如何准确有效地获取id,对于实现各种交互效果和操作网页元素至关重要。
在JavaScript里,获取id最常用的方法是使用document.getElementById()函数。这个函数接收一个字符串参数,该字符串就是你想要获取元素的id值。例如,在HTML中有一个<div>元素,它的id是“myDiv”,即<div id="myDiv">这是一个测试div</div>。在JavaScript中,你可以这样获取这个元素:var myElement = document.getElementById('myDiv');。这里,document代表整个HTML文档,getElementById明确告诉浏览器要通过id来查找元素,而变量myElement则存储了找到的元素对象。通过这个对象,你可以对该元素进行各种操作,比如修改其文本内容、样式等。例如myElement.textContent = '新的文本内容';就改变了<div>里的文本。
除了document.getElementById()方法,在现代JavaScript中,还有其他获取元素的方式也可用于获取特定id的元素。比如querySelector方法。你可以使用CSS选择器的语法来获取元素。例如var newElement = document.querySelector('#myDiv');,这里的#符号在CSS选择器中表示通过id来选择元素。虽然querySelector功能更强大,可使用各种CSS选择器模式,但document.getElementById()在性能上相对更优,因为它专门针对通过id获取元素进行了优化。
另外,querySelectorAll方法也可以获取带有特定id的元素,不过它会返回一个包含所有匹配元素的静态NodeList集合。即使只有一个匹配id的元素,返回的也是一个集合。例如var elements = document.querySelectorAll('#myDiv');,若要访问其中的元素,需要通过索引,如var singleElement = elements[0]; 。
在JavaScript中获取一个id有多种方式。熟练掌握这些方法,能让开发者根据实际情况选择最适合的方式,高效地操作网页中的元素,为实现丰富的交互效果和功能打下坚实基础。
TAGS: 前端开发 JavaScript JavaScript方法 获取ID
- pandas统计转换后列数据的使用方法
- Flet订阅广播失败:接收方收不到消息的原因
- 正则表达式匹配第一个闭合标签后停止的方法
- 编写 EB 账单计算器程序
- Flet广播订阅失效,为何只能收到自己消息
- Python使用subprocess.Popen调用exe文件时为何会卡住
- 如何解决Python subprocess.Popen调用exe文件时的卡住问题
- Python Selenium多线程爬虫报错之避免端口冲突方法
- 用虚拟变量编码统计不同日期不同数据类型出现次数的方法
- Python使用subprocess.Popen调用exe文件时出现卡顿如何解决
- 10小时速通编程入门,小白如何快速掌握编程核心
- 10小时速通编程基础:怎样在最短时间掌握编程核心技能
- 用Python获取可执行文件对应进程PID的方法
- Pandas中不同结构DataFrame的整列复制方法
- 10小时速通编程:怎样高效为初学者传授编程基础